Hi All, Here are the latest gdb patches for S/390, they are against yesterdays repository ( Feb 26th ) I have spent a lot of time reworking the stuff to get it down to as few files as possible, & addressing issues brought up on previous submissions ( a hell of a lot more time than the 64 bit port took :-) ). & hope it is accepted this time. The only thing I'm aware of which isn't working properly is gdb /boot/vmlinux /proc/kcore when compiled for multiarch This is because the bfd stuff returns bfd_arch_unknown & set_gdbarch_from_file complains because gdbarch_update_p can't fix up this, this however is quite normal for the /proc/kcore file even when compiled without multi-arch, the code works fine when compiled without multi-arch.
